Latest Patents
Kirpal holds a patent for a "Method and system for form-filling crawl and associating rich keywords." This innovative technique enables the efficient location, processing, and retrieval of local product information derived from various web pages accessible through form queries. His technology specifically tackles the challenges associated with the deep web, where valuable data is often hidden from traditional search engines. The patent outlines an automated information extraction process that employs deep-web crawling, ensuring that business records are accurately extracted and integrated into a comprehensive business listing database.

Collaborations
In his journey as an inventor, Kirpal has collaborated with talented colleagues such as Nilesh Dalvi and Raghu Ramakrishnan. Their combined efforts have contributed to the evolution of web crawling technologies, allowing for enhanced data retrieval methods that benefit numerous industries reliant on precise product information.
